Can 2 people use the same Help to Buy ISA?

Help to Buy ISA is open to individuals aged 18 years and older. It is forbidden to open an ISA on behalf of another person as it is only available to individuals. With this, you cannot buy a home with another person even if he or she is also a first-time buyer. Instead, you can open an account and save money on each of your accounts. This is the only option as 2 people cannot use the same Help to Buy ISA. If your prospective property is within the government’s price cap for Help to Buy ISA, you can each separately claim your savings and government bonuses. You can then put them together for the payment of your prospective home. With this, the two of you can pool enough money for your ideal home using your government cash bonuses.
